Output 38edb5654cacf77863dcd9af92aecd97afa2877732bf42106659a6eac1ba0552:1

value
17200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 703cb80d09efe7380370ab28da5d72b8d246e802 OP_EQUALVERIFY OP_CHECKSIG
address
1BETRK52V7pEYhvMib1rYEimen33gdWygX
transaction
38edb5654cacf77863dcd9af92aecd97afa2877732bf42106659a6eac1ba0552
spent
true